report says tax threatens U.K. remote gambling industry
March 26, 2005 - A report commissioned by ARGO and published
today by Europe Economics found that unless HM Treasury finds a
way to reduce the potential tax liabilities for online gaming operators
then there is little or no incentive for any of the major players,
whose remote gaming operations are all presently based offshore,
to be located in the UK when the Gambling Bill comes into force.

Turkish
anti online gambling bill proposed
March 11, 2005 - According to the Turkish daily news the
burgeoning Internet gambling industry in Turkey could face legislative
difficulties in the months ahead. Government ministries and other
organizations are to launch a campaign to fight online gambling
and betting, by blocking Web sites, following credit card transactions
and introducing new taxes.

IGC
terminates membership of Gambling Federation
March 11, 2005 - The Interactive Gaming Council today accepted
the resignation of Flaviano Fogli from its Board of Directors. The
IGC Board has also terminated, by unanimous vote, the membership
of the Gambling Federation, a Canadian company for which Fogli serves
as chief executive officer.

CAP
terminates Gambling Federation membership
March 11, 2005 - CasinoAffiliatePrograms.com (“CAP”)
a leading online gaming industry resource, announced today that
they are revoking the certification of Gambling Federation. The
decision is in response to published reports that Gambling Federation
had installed malware (malicious software) in their software and
their recent termination from The Interactive Gaming Council (“IGC”).

Record
profits for Ladbrokes
March 6, 2005 - Ladbrokes, the UK bookmaker owned by the
Hilton Group, unveiled record profits this week, up 28 per cent
to GBP 273 million, with valuable contributions from internet gambling
and virtual roulette machines.

IGC
strongly supports North Dakota poker bill
March 3, 2005 - The Interactive Gaming Council strongly supports
a bill passed by the North Dakota House of Representatives that
would legalize online poker and establish a structure to regulate
and tax this form of entertainment. The bill passed the House on
Feb. 16 and will be the subject of a hearing in the state Senate
on March 8.
